Q: Why do Fernwick scanner reads fail on curved labels? A: The Brightscan integration rejects frames below 70% decode confidence, and curved packaging drops us under that threshold. Mitigation is a two-frame merge we shipped last sprint, currently behind a flag. Rollout status and the flag toggle instructions are tracked on the internal page below.

dashboard of hadug-fawep = https://artifactory.braskhq.test/deploy

From the outgoing Director of Treasury to the incoming Director, for distribution to branch managers. The Q3 forecast assumes steady receivables from the Aldercroft and Pellinsby branches, with a modest drawdown on the revolving facility in August to cover seasonal inventory. Watch the Torvale account closely; payment terms were renegotiated and collections may lag. All supporting models are in the shared planning folder. Branch-level targets remain unchanged pending board review. A confidential note on broader business plans follows below.

board note of bawep-tajef: Queniusek Systems plans to raise the Quenvan list price by 53.1 percent in March. The pricing group signed off on a budget of $176.4 million for Project Drueth. The renewal with Casionix Partners closes at $142.5 million a year, 8.3 percent below the last contract. Project Fraax slips by six weeks because of the tooling delay.

Handover: Quickfind autocomplete index, from Dara to Miko. The prefix index on the Orlan cluster rebuilds nightly and has been running slow — about 4 hours versus the usual 40 minutes. I suspect the tokenizer change from last sprint; reverting it locally fixed things. Benchmarks are in the shared drive, snapshot encrypted as usual. Before you can open the snapshot and confirm, you'll need the recovery passphrase, which is:

unlock words, fahog-yahof: belael-holael-eliius-joreth-tamax-olimir-norwyn-holwyn-fraath-lamius-norwyn-druys-soriel

## Local Setup — Snapshot Tests

The Tindermoor UI kit uses snapshot tests to catch unintended rendering changes. After cloning, run `npm run snap:baseline` to generate reference images; diffs appear in `artifacts/snapshots`. Support staff reproducing a customer-reported visual bug should always regenerate baselines first, since stale ones cause false failures. Snapshot metadata and historical diff records are stored centrally, and the test runner reads them using the connection string below.

replica DSN, kajep-yahag: mssql://praok_svc:iF@db-8d68.plorvaio.local:5432/eliion